Naira drops N14, trades at N1,577/$1 on official exchanges

Nigeria’s currency, the naira started the week with a decline against the US dollar on Monday, July 15, 2024.

The local currency weakened by N14 to trade at N1,577/$1, data from the Nigerian Autonomous Foreign Exchange Market (NAFEM) showed.

This is in contrast to the exchange rate of N1.563/$1 traded on Friday, July 12, 2024.

The highest and lowest intraday prices recorded during the day were N1,590/$1 and N1,470/$1 respectively, indicating a very tight spread of N120\$1.

The naira lost N5 against the dollar in the parallel market and was trading at N1,565|$1, against an exchange rate of N1,560/$1 in the previous trading day.

The Naira crossed the N2,000 mark as it lost N10 against the British Pound and was trading at N2,050\£1 compared to the previous trading day’s exchange rate of N2,040\£1 reflecting a loss of N10 for the local currency.

The Canadian dollar continued to close flat against the naira and traded at N1,200|CA$1, the same as the previous day’s trading value of N1,200|CA$1.

The Naira lost N15 against the Euro and was trading at ₦1,690/€1 compared to the previous trading day’s exchange rate of ₦1,675/€1.
